Analysis

In 2024, grassland — burning crop residues in Ecuador stood at 58,406 t.

Compared with earlier readings it is up 426.7% on the previous year and up 3,070.6% over ten years.

Over the whole period, grassland — burning crop residues in Ecuador peaked at 62,274 t in 2022 and was at its lowest, 889.05 t, in 2008.

Ecuador ranks 73rd of 220 countries on this measure, in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
